Contributing to irouter
Thank you for your interest in contributing to irouter
! We aim to make accessing 100's of LLMs as simple as possible.
Openrouter.ai is used under the hood to access LLMs through their API.

Development Guidelines
Code Standards
- Use appropriate type hints (Python 3.10+ syntax)
- Keep docstrings concise but complete (reStructured format)
- Add new dependencies via
uv add <package>

Pull Requests
- Keep PRs focused on a single change
- Include tests for new features and bug fixes
- Update documentation as needed
- Reference related issues

Bug Reports
Include:
- Error messages and stack traces
- Code that reproduces the issue
- Environment details (Python version, OS)
- Expected vs actual behavior
